Footnotes 2012

indoor / stage work

Footnotes is a performance of physical and spatial illusion based on Ilona Jäntti’s MA Choreography thesis research at Laban Centre.

“You forget the floor exists. She is gentle, subtle and funny, captivating us with a raised eyebrow, even when she’s upside down.” – Theatre Bristol

“We held our breath as she hung high above the stage with only her extended leg touching the bar and holding her up. A collective sigh of relief went through the audience when her feet returned to the stage.”  – Charleston Paper (USA)
